Understanding Odds and Probability

At the core of sports betting lies the understanding of odds and their relationship to probability. Odds aren't simply numbers; they represent the likelihood of a particular outcome occurring, as perceived by the bookmaker. Different formats – decimal, fractional, and American – each express this probability in a unique way. Decimal odds, common in Europe and Australia, represent the total payout for every unit wagered, including the return of the stake. Fractional odds, widely used in the UK, display the profit relative to the stake. American odds, prevalent in the US, indicate either the amount you need to wager to win $100 or the amount you’ll win on a $100 wager. Deciphering these formats is the first step towards making informed betting decisions. Understanding implied probability, derived from the odds, allows bettors to assess whether the bookmaker's perception aligns with their own analysis of the event.

The Importance of Value Betting

The concept of value betting is central to long-term profitability. It involves identifying bets where the odds offered by the bookmaker are higher than the implied probability of the outcome occurring, according to your own assessment. This requires independent analysis, considering factors the bookmaker may have underestimated. For example, a team might be undervalued due to a recent losing streak, despite having a strong underlying performance or benefiting from key player returns. Finding these discrepancies – the "value" – is the key to consistently beating the market. Conducting thorough research, comparing odds across multiple bookmakers, and developing a disciplined approach to bet selection are all crucial components of a successful value betting strategy. It's about recognizing opportunities where the risk-reward ratio is skewed in your favor.

Odd Format Example Explanation
Decimal 2.00 A $10 bet returns $20 (including the original stake).
Fractional 1/1 A $10 bet returns a profit of $10.
American +100 A $100 bet wins $100 profit.

Bankroll Management Strategies

Effective bankroll management is arguably more important than identifying winning bets. It involves carefully controlling the amount of money allocated to betting and implementing strategies to minimize the risk of significant losses. A common rule of thumb is to only wager a small percentage of your bankroll on any single bet – typically between 1% and 5%. This approach safeguards against the impact of losing streaks and allows you to weather periods of variance. Furthermore, it’s essential to establish a clear budget and stick to it, avoiding the temptation to chase losses or increase stakes impulsively. Keeping detailed records of all bets, including stakes, odds, and outcomes, is also crucial for tracking performance and identifying areas for improvement.

The Kelly Criterion

For more sophisticated bankroll management, the Kelly Criterion offers a mathematically derived approach to determining the optimal percentage of your bankroll to wager on each bet. It takes into account your perceived edge (the difference between your estimated probability and the implied probability) and calculates the proportion of your bankroll that maximizes long-term growth. However, the Kelly Criterion can be aggressive and lead to substantial volatility, so many bettors opt to use a fractional Kelly, wagering a smaller percentage than the full calculation suggests. Understanding the principles behind the Kelly Criterion can provide a valuable framework for making informed decisions about stake sizing, but it requires a high degree of accuracy in estimating probabilities.

Utilizing Statistical Analysis and Trends

Data analysis plays an increasingly important role in modern sports betting. By examining historical data, identifying patterns, and applying statistical models, bettors can gain valuable insights into the potential outcomes of events. Key statistics to consider include team form, head-to-head records, home/away performance, player statistics, and recent injuries. Advanced metrics, such as expected goals (xG) in soccer, can provide a more nuanced understanding of team performance than traditional statistics alone. However, it’s crucial to remember that past performance is not necessarily indicative of future results, and external factors can significantly impact outcomes. Statistical analysis should be used as a tool to inform your decision-making, not as a substitute for critical thinking.

The Role of Regression Analysis

Regression analysis is a statistical technique used to examine the relationship between variables. In the context of sports betting, it can be used to identify factors that have a significant impact on outcomes. For example, you might use regression analysis to determine the correlation between a team's possession percentage and their goal-scoring rate. This type of analysis can help you identify undervalued teams or players and make more informed betting decisions. However, it’s important to ensure that your data is reliable and that your model is appropriately specified to avoid spurious correlations. Remember that complex statistical models do not guarantee accurate predictions, and human judgment remains essential.

The Psychology of Betting and Avoiding Common Pitfalls

Successful betting isn’t purely about mathematical calculation; the psychological aspect is often underestimated. Emotional biases can significantly cloud judgment and lead to poor decision-making. Common pitfalls include chasing losses, confirmation bias (seeking out information that confirms your existing beliefs), and the gambler's fallacy (believing that past events influence future independent events). Maintaining objectivity, sticking to your pre-defined strategy, and avoiding impulsive bets are essential for mitigating these psychological traps. It is also vital to recognize when to step away from betting if you are feeling stressed or emotionally invested in the outcome.
